Lit des octets de données en provenance du périphérique adressé précédemment.

RcvRespMsg suppose qu'une autre fonction, comme ReceiveSetup, Receive ou SendCmds, a déjà adressé les émetteurs et les récepteurs GPIB. Utilisez RcvRespMsg spécifiquement pour sauter l'étape d'adressage dans la gestion GPIB. Vous utilisez normalement la fonction Receive pour réaliser toute la séquence d'adressage et recevoir les octets de données.

Reportez-vous à la rubrique Valeurs par défaut des fonctions GPIB pour obtenir des informations complémentaires sur les valeurs de timeout et d'adresse par défaut.


icon

Entrées/Sorties

  • ci32.png bus

    bus fait référence au numéro du bus GPIB. Si vous ne disposez que d'une interface GPIB dans votre ordinateur, le numéro de bus par défaut est 0.

    Consultez les instructions d'installation du logiciel fournies avec le contrôleur GPIB pour des interfaces GPIB supplémentaires.
  • ci16.png mode

    mode détermine la méthode de terminaison des données.

    La valeur par défaut est 0. Si mode est égal à une valeur comprise entre décimal 0 et 255, le caractère ASCII qui lui correspond équivaut au caractère de terminaison et la fonction arrête la lecture lorsqu'elle détecte le caractère. Si mode n'est pas câblé ou est égal à décimal 256, la fonction arrête la lecture lorsqu'elle détecte le message FIN (EOI).
  • ci32.png nombre

    nombre représente le nombre maximum d'octets de données à lire depuis le GPIB.

  • cerrcodeclst.png entrée d'erreur

    entrée d'erreur décrit les conditions d'erreur qui ont lieu avant l'exécution de ce nœud. Cette entrée fournit la fonctionnalité entrée d'erreur standard.

  • istr.png chaîne de données

    chaîne de données contient les octets lus du GPIB.

  • i1dbool.png état

    état représente un tableau de booléens dans lequel chaque bit décrit un état du contrôleur GPIB.

    Si une erreur se produit, la fonction définit le bit 15 à 1. erreur GPIB n'est valide que si le bit 15 d'état est défini à 1.

    Le tableau suivant présente la valeur numérique et l'état symbolique de chaque bit d'état. Ce tableau propose également une description de chaque bit.
    Bit d'étatValeur numériqueÉtat symboliqueDescription
    01DCASRéinitialisation du périphérique
    12DTASDéclenchement du périphérique
    24LACSRécepteur Actif (Listener Active)
    38TACSÉmetteur actif (Talker Active)
    416ATNAttention activée (Attention Asserted)
    532CICContrôleur en charge (Controller-In-Charge)
    664REMÉtat déporté (Remote State)
    7128LOKÉtat Lockout (Lockout State)
    8256CMPLOpération terminée (Operation Completed)
    124096SRQISRQ détectée pendant l'état de contrôleur en charge (SRQ Detected while CIC)
    138192FINEOI ou EOS détecté
    1416384TIMOTimeout
    15-32768ERRErreur détectée
  • ii32.png nombre d'octets

    nombre d'octets fait référence au nombre d'octets qui transitent par le GPIB.

  • ierrcodeclst.png sortie d'erreur

    sortie d'erreur contient des informations sur l'erreur. Cette sortie fournit la fonctionnalité sortie d'erreur standard.